Verwendung von nicht deklarierter Bezeichner 'kUTTypeMovie'
Bin ich immer die Fehlermeldung - Verwendung von nicht deklarierter Bezeichner 'kUTTypeMovie'
in der folgenden code -
-(IBAction)selectVideo:(id)sender {
UIImagePickerController *imagePicker = [[UIImagePickerController alloc] init];
imagePicker.sourceType = UIImagePickerControllerSourceTypeSavedPhotosAlbum;
imagePicker.mediaTypes = [[NSArray alloc] initWithObjects:(NSString *)kUTTypeMovie, nil];
imagePicker.delegate = self;
[self presentModalViewController:imagePicker animated:YES];
}
Was ist Los mit ihm?
InformationsquelleAutor Ashish Agarwal | 2012-08-01
Du musst angemeldet sein, um einen Kommentar abzugeben.
Müssen Sie die framework-MobileCoreServices für das Projekt, und importieren Sie dann:
Ziel C:
Machen das problem Weg.
Swift 4:
@import MobileCoreServices;
- für Objective-CInformationsquelleAutor The dude
swift
objective c
InformationsquelleAutor budidino
Ich bin ein Neuling bei iOS Entwicklung, xcode und verbrachte einige Zeit versucht, herauszufinden, warum gerade der import nicht funktioniert. Nach herauszufinden, das problem mit einem erfahrenen Mitglied aus meinem team fand ich heraus, dass es nicht nur Sie gehören
aber Sie müssen auch link-Binärdateien mit der Bibliothek der MobileCoreServices Rahmen zu bauen, die Phasen Ihres Projekts.
Hoffe, das hilft! Ich brauchte diese info, wenn ich das Tue.
InformationsquelleAutor Josh Lowe
Swift 4 Antwort, mit der video-Kamera-code und imagePicker delegieren:
Öffnen Sie Die Video-Kamera
ImagePicker delegieren:
InformationsquelleAutor xscoder
#import <MobileCoreServices/MobileCoreServices.h>
InformationsquelleAutor Ram G.
import MobileCoreServices
für swift@import MobileCoreServices;
für objective cInformationsquelleAutor Naqeeb Ahmed